如何利用AI实时语音开发个性化语音助手?
在数字化时代,人工智能技术已经渗透到了我们生活的方方面面。语音助手作为人工智能的重要应用之一,已经成为了许多人的日常伴侣。随着AI技术的不断进步,个性化语音助手越来越受到人们的关注。那么,如何利用AI实时语音开发个性化语音助手呢?下面,让我们通过一个故事来了解一下。
小明是一名IT行业从业者,他热衷于人工智能技术的研究与应用。最近,小明在思考一个问题:如何开发一个真正属于自己、能满足自己需求的个性化语音助手呢?于是,他开始了自己的探索之旅。
第一步:收集需求与数据
小明深知,开发一个个性化语音助手的前提是了解用户的需求。于是,他开始向身边的亲朋好友询问,了解他们对于语音助手的需求。同时,他还通过线上问卷调查、社交媒体等方式,收集了大量用户的需求信息。
在收集到需求信息后,小明发现,用户对于个性化语音助手的需求主要集中在以下几个方面:
智能识别用户语音:能够准确识别用户的语音,并理解其意图。
个性化推荐:根据用户的喜好,提供个性化的内容推荐。
多场景应用:满足用户在不同场景下的需求,如生活、工作、娱乐等。
高度智能化:能够主动学习用户的习惯,提供更加智能的服务。
为了满足这些需求,小明开始收集相关的数据。他利用开源语音识别技术,收集了大量用户的语音数据,并对其进行标注和整理。
第二步:技术选型与实现
在确定了需求和数据后,小明开始进行技术选型。他选择了以下几种技术:
语音识别:利用开源的语音识别技术,如Google的Speech-to-Text、百度语音识别等,实现语音的实时转换成文字。
自然语言处理(NLP):通过NLP技术,对用户输入的文字进行分析,理解其意图。
个性化推荐:利用机器学习算法,如协同过滤、内容推荐等,实现个性化推荐。
智能化学习:通过深度学习技术,如循环神经网络(RNN)、长短期记忆网络(LSTM)等,实现智能化的主动学习。
在技术实现方面,小明遵循以下步骤:
语音识别:将用户的语音输入转换为文字,利用NLP技术进行分析。
意图识别:根据用户的语音输入,判断其意图,如查询天气、播放音乐等。
个性化推荐:根据用户的喜好和历史行为,推荐相应的内容。
智能化学习:不断学习用户的习惯,优化语音助手的表现。
第三步:测试与优化
在完成初步的技术实现后,小明对语音助手进行了严格的测试。他邀请了多位用户进行体验,收集他们的反馈意见。在测试过程中,小明发现以下问题:
语音识别准确率有待提高。
个性化推荐内容与用户需求不完全匹配。
语音助手在某些场景下表现不佳。
针对这些问题,小明进行了以下优化:
提高语音识别准确率:通过不断优化模型,提高语音识别的准确率。
优化个性化推荐算法:根据用户反馈,调整推荐算法,提高推荐内容的匹配度。
丰富语音助手的功能:针对不同场景,开发更多实用功能,提升用户体验。
第四步:推广应用与持续迭代
在完成优化后,小明将个性化语音助手推向市场。他通过线上线下的渠道,让更多用户了解并使用这个产品。在推广过程中,小明密切关注用户反馈,不断收集用户需求,持续迭代优化语音助手。
经过一段时间的推广应用,小明发现,个性化语音助手得到了越来越多用户的认可。许多用户表示,这个产品极大地提高了他们的生活质量,为他们带来了便捷。
总结
通过小明的故事,我们了解到,利用AI实时语音开发个性化语音助手并非遥不可及。只需遵循以下步骤,我们就可以打造一个真正属于自己、能满足自己需求的个性化语音助手:
收集需求与数据。
技术选型与实现。
测试与优化。
推广应用与持续迭代。
在未来的发展中,相信人工智能技术将为我们的生活带来更多惊喜。让我们一起期待个性化语音助手的更加美好的未来!
猜你喜欢:AI机器人